1. Relaxed Dressing Style: Going Out Can Never Be This Easy
For a couple who wants to dress down but in a fashionable way, casual couple outfits allow people to dress with minimum fuss and still look good. While going for casual walks or gatherings like going out for brunch or running on weekends, the bearer should select soft and light fabrics for the shirts as well as the dresses.
- Style Tips: Combine a men’s linen or chambray shirt with a sundress. This looks good because it adopts a relaxed feeling and still makes sense comfort-wise as well as look.
- Color Coordination: Adequate colour blending can also create an appealing appearance to the couple’s outfit. Use light pastels or neutral colours and create a consistent feel. Light blue, light cream, and light pink colours are excellent colours of this type, as they are lightweight and complement a refreshing casual style.

5. Beach and Vacation Looks: Light and Breezy Style
When in need of pure relaxation during beach vacations, there is no way to capture those moments of carefreeness in the sunlight other than in coordinated outfits. Pieces that are light and airy should form a focal point in clothing for such a warm and breezy look.
- Style Tips: Consider a men’s floral or Hawaiian shirt together with a matching sundress. You could also wear light cotton or linen, which are excellently suited for hot and humid weather conditions.
- Color Coordination: There are light and bright colours with amusing prints, which are very good additions when going out. For example, turquoise green or coral is an excellent tropical colour that should be considered.
- Outfit Examples: Consider wearing a boldly coloured Hawaiian shirt and a sundress in a contrasting bright colour. Alternatively, consider wearing a soft linen shirt with a sundress that is floral and breezy.
These coordinated outfits, when taken for the beach, enhance the appearance of photos in a very effortless manner as these also use sun-friendly fabrics to keep one comfortable throughout the day.
6. Fall and Winter Layers: Cool yet Warm Coordination.
Cooler seasons are the best for snuggling in warm clothes and also encourage the concept of coordinated style couples. Fall and winter fashion can be complemented with jackets, scarves, and boots, keeping them warm and chic at the same time.
- Style Tip: A cosy sweater dress can be styled with a men’s flannel shirt. To wear these looks outdoors, add accessories such as scarves, hats, and boots for extra warmth.
- Color Coordination: For fall, colour earth tones like burgundy, forest, and mustard. For winter, classic winter whites, greys, and deep blue colours.
- Outfit Examples: A flannel shirt and a sweater dress or long-sleeve shirt with a winter dress and a scarf complete the winter look.
Layered outfits are a practical solution to weather-related concerns but advance the winter or any seasonal style with just a few mixed pieces.
